Klappentext This book, first published in 1926, was written 'to present the subject of heat-engines, in their mechanical as well as their thermodynamical aspects'. Zusammenfassung Sir James Alfred Ewing (1855–1935) was a Scottish engineer, physicist and cryptographer. First published in 1926, as the fourth edition of an 1894 original, this book was written by Ewing 'to present the subject of heat-engines, in their mechanical as well as their thermodynamical aspects'. Inhaltsverzeichnis Preface; 1. The early history of the steam-engine; 2. Elementary theory of heat-engines; 3. Properties of steam and elementary theory of the steam-engine; 4. Further points in the theory of heat-engines; 5. Entropy; 6. Reversal of the heat-engine: mechanical refrigeration; 7. Actual behaviour of steam in the cylinder; 8. Steam turbines; 9. The testing of heat-engines; 10. Compound expansion; 11. Valves and valve-gears; 12. Governing; 13. Dynamics of the reciprocating engine; 14. The formation of steam; 15. Forms of the steam engine; 16. Air engines; 17. Gas-engines and oil-engines; Appendix. Tables of the properties of steam; Index.
